Latest Patents

Skinner's latest patents focus on the reproducible selection of members in a hierarchy. The method he developed involves determining a sequence of one or more actions associated with a member selection tree. These actions collectively select one or more members from a hierarchy of members, which is associated with a specific dimension of an organization of data. The method also includes recording the sequence of actions in a member selection script. Furthermore, it allows for the execution of the member selection script to select one or more members after the hierarchy has been modified.
